Biography

French artist Claude Morin was born in Lorraine in 1946. After attending the National Superior School of Decorative Arts of Strasbourg and Fine Arts of Lausanne, he created his first sculpture for President Georges Pompidou. Alain Coudert summarizes Morin’s style: "There is something of Faust in this man who, through an art mastered to perfection, appeals to the eternal freshness of feeling.” His works are present in numerous private collections in France and abroad.
